## What it is
Kimi-VL is an open-source Mixture-of-Experts vision-language model (VLM) with a 2.8B activated parameter language decoder, offering multimodal reasoning, 128K long-context understanding, OCR, and agent capabilities. It includes a long-thinking variant trained with chain-of-thought SFT and reinforcement learning, with weights available on Hugging Face.
